Cutting-Edge Precision Irrigation Sprinklers
Optimizing water use is vital for sustainable agriculture and responsible landscaping. Leveraging precision irrigation sprinklers presents a effective solution to achieve this goal. These sophisticated systems dispense water directly to plant roots, minimizing water waste and enhancing crop yields.
Precision irrigation sprinklers often incorporate sensors and controllers that track soil moisture levels and weather conditions. This real-time data facilitates the system to automatically adjust watering schedules and supply the precise amount of water essential.
- Moreover, precision irrigation sprinklers can be customized to accommodate the specific needs of different crops or plant varieties. This degree of customization ensures optimal water delivery for each species.
- Consequently, the use of precision irrigation sprinklers contributes in several advantages, including water conservation, cost savings, increased crop production, and improved soil health.
Sustain Your Irrigation Sprinklers in Tip-Top Shape
To guarantee the longevity of your irrigation sprinklers, regular maintenance is key. Begin by observing your sprinkler system at least once a month for any indications of damage or leaks. Completely wash the sprinkler heads with a brush to eliminate debris and mineral buildup. Consider applying a gentle cleaning solution if necessary. Ensure that all sprinkler heads are directed correctly to distribute water evenly across your lawn.
- Inspect the pressure valve periodically to ensure optimal water pressure.
- Empty your sprinkler system in the fall to prevent freeze damage during winter months.
- Seek out a professional irrigation specialist for any repairs or maintenance tasks you are uncomfortable to perform yourself.
